Population Mean
The average value of all the members of a set or population, denoting the central tendency.
Null Hypothesis
An assumption made for a statistical test that there is no significant difference or effect, to be tested against the alternative hypothesis.
Equality Sign
A symbol used in mathematics to indicate that two expressions on either side of the sign are equal in value.
Type I Error
The mistake of rejecting the null hypothesis when it is actually true, falsely indicating a significant effect or difference.
